Terrazzo work complete at T.I.A.
By: Mark Naugle
Steward-Mellon has completed the terrazzo work on the Tampa International Airport baggage claim! This project, 31,000 square feet of three color terrazzo was done in over 50 “microphases”. Gresham-Smith and Partners designed this beautiful project.

ensuring quality and service
By: Mark Naugle
Quality and service. These are the marketing bywords of most any terrazzo/stone/industrial flooring contracting firm interested in your business. What sets Steward-Mellon Company apart? Our culture and our process. I am dismayed by the plethora of competing subcontractors who bid projects, ostensibly “per plans and specs”, and who later hit the owners with a slough of extras for “premium aggregates” on the front side and “unforeseen leveling” once the job starts. It is truly not a level playing field when every bid does not include pricing per the control sample, nor do they include, up front, the potential costs for unforeseen jobsite conditions such as moisture mitigation and crack suppression.

tampa, florida - public art collaboration with Wendy Babcox
By: Mark Naugle
We here at Steward-Mellon are proud to have recently participated in a couple of beautiful Art in Public Places projects at the new Economy Parking Garage at the Tampa International Airport
. The Western elevator lobby contains a site-specific art piece by Wendy Babcox
entitled Sea Shadows.
